what is formed when atoms join together with a covalent bond?

Respuesta :

joyousjennah
joyousjennah joyousjennah
  • 04-04-2020

Answer:

A molecule

Explanation:

A covalent bond is formed by the sharing of electrons between atoms.

if you put two hydrogen atoms together with a covalent bond, you will get H_2, which is a hydrogen molecule
